34 % = 0.34

6 % = 0.06

36 % = 0.36

87.8 % = 0.878

77 % = 0.77

14 % = 0.14

TO FIND THE DECIMAL, DIVIDE THE PERCENTAGE OVER 100 LIKE SO:

ie. 14÷100 = 0.14

A manufacturer has a monthly fixed cost of $110,000 and a production cost of $14 for each unit produced. The product sells for $
vova2212 [387]

Answer:

Cost function C(x) == FC + VC*Q

Revenue function R(x) = Px * Q

Profit function P(x) =(Px * Q)-(FC + VC*Q)

P(12000) = -38000 Loss

P(23000) = 28000 profit

Step-by-step explanation:

Total Cost is Fixed cost plus Variable cost multiplied by the produce quantity.  

(a)Cost function

C(x) = FC + vc*Q

Where  

FC=Fixed cost

VC=Variable cost

Q=produce quantity

(b)

Revenue function

R(x) = Px * Q

Where  

Px= Sales Price

Q=produce quantity

(c) Profit function

Profit = Revenue- Total cost

P(x) =(Px * Q)-(FC + vc*Q)

(d) We have to replace in the profit function

<u>at 12,000 units </u>

P(12000) =($20 * 12,000)-($110,000 + $14*12,000)

P(12000) = -38000

<u>at 23,000 units </u>

P(x) =($20 * 23,000)-($110,000 + $14*23,000)

P(23000) = 28000
